A glowing greenish yellow colour with intense golden highlights. A complex and elegant nose expresses the varietal character of French Viognier, as well as the northern Greek Assyrtiko. Expressive aromas of ripe apricot, flowers, and citrus fruit peel, together with tropical fruits and lots of white flowers, making its nose irresistible. The flavours in the mouth follow the aromas of the nose and the aftertaste is intense and long, with sweet spices such as vanilla increasing the complexity, creating the feeling that it will last forever. It is full, creamy, and rich, with an exceptional structure and crisp acidity in the mouth. The barrel’s personality - vanilla, tobacco, and nuts - is beautifully incorporated into the wine, composing a rich bouquet of aromas, while the scent of bread crust indicates contact with the lees. An excellent companion to fresh seafood, such as lobster, crab, or shrimps in a white sauce. It pairs perfectly with Asian cuisine, roast fish with oily flesh, as well as oven roast fish with herbs (rosemary, parsley, or even thyme), chicken and pork in white sauces, grilled vegetables and asparagus. Aged yellow cheeses at the end of a meal.
